Output 5c5089e161483380a9b2473a4df84bae90f14166206cd00426d48742926f08d0:0

value
1087494819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f7509ebd997455645ee467038e75a0015beece OP_EQUAL
address
384xpXEbC3tFmCZmTQdUPr5kdiEfwKGcwu
transaction
5c5089e161483380a9b2473a4df84bae90f14166206cd00426d48742926f08d0
spent
true